Abstract (en)

The method of the long-term storage of waste nuclear fuel of a nuclear reactor consists in that, first, prior to the waste fuel assembly of the nuclear reactor being disposed in a steel case and latter being hermetically sealed with a cover, a material which is chemically inert in relation to the material of the casing of the fuel elements of the waste fuel assemblies, to the material of the body of the case, to air and to water, is arranged in the steel case, the steel case is mounted in a heating device, the steel case is heated along with the material arranged in said steel case until said material passes into a liquid state, and then the waste fuel assembly which has been extracted from the nuclear reactor is arranged in the steel case in such a way that the fuel pat of the fuel elements of the waste fuel assemblies is lower than the level of the liquid material in steel case, the waste fuel assembly is fixed in this position, and the case is hermetically sealed the cover, whereupon the hermetically sealed case is extracted from the heating device and mounted in a storage facility which is cooled by atmospheric air. This technical solution makes it possible to ensure long-term safe storage of waste fuel assemblies of a nuclear reactor in storage facilities with cooling using atmospheric air, in particular with natural circulation of atmospheric air, and also to transport the waste of the fuel assemblies to a factory for processing so as to ensure an increased level of safety.
